> On 27 November 2013, I said:
>> I'm hacking on a task distribution system used internally here. It has
>> N masters sending tasks (shell commands) out to M workers, and then
>> doing stuff with the results. There's something that annoys me
>> slightly about the implementation: the worker runs each task in a
>> separate thread.
>>
>> IMHO it would be ever so much nicer to just spawn the child process
>> that runs a task, and harvest the results when they are ready. IOW, I
>> want to integrate wait() and zmq_poll() in a single event loop.
